On March 1st of this year, the Hengqin Guangdong Macao Deep Cooperation Zone celebrated its second anniversary of implementing the policy of branch line management. Gongbei Customs announced today that in the past two years (March 1, 2024- February 28, 26), the customs has inspected and released more than 55.5 million inbound and outbound personnel and 6.26 million vehicles on the "front line", a year-on-year increase of 102% and 87.7% compared to before the line management; The cumulative number of vehicles released in the "second tier" area has exceeded 41.25 million. There are 2363 enterprises registered with the customs, and the import and export value of enterprises in the Hengqin Cooperation Zone is 69.69 billion yuan from 2024 to 2025, with an average annual growth rate of 31.8%.

Driving into the country from Hengqin Port, the country's first "Guangdong Macao Joint One Stop" efficient operation of passenger and freight vehicles can complete the inspection of 5 units in both places with one stop. Over the past two years, Gongbei Customs has continued to solidify the dividends of this innovative model: the number of channels has expanded from 15 to 30, freight functions have been restored, Qin'ao students have been able to clear customs without getting off the car, and various livelihood measures such as Qin'ao's "hospital hospital" point-to-point transportation have been implemented, and "settling down+life" and "education+medical care" have fully bloomed.

Nowadays, Hengqin has become the most concentrated area for mainland Australians and Australian enterprises. The number of Australian funded enterprises has exceeded 7600, and the number of Macau residents living and working has reached 30000. The cross-border traffic and passenger flow between Qinhuangdao and Macau have repeatedly reached new highs, with a maximum of 13737 vehicles and 147000 people per day, which is 2.3 times and 3.1 times higher than the first day of implementation of branch line management. With the introduction of a new round of measures to support and serve the construction of the Hengqin Cooperation Zone by customs, regulatory policies such as facilitating the entry and exit of single license plate operating vehicles in Macau are being studied at an accelerated pace, adding new expectations for customs clearance convenience.

Breaking through the impasse: New business models bring more vitality to life

On February 27th, a truck carrying integrated circuit chips entered the customs inspection site through the "second-line" Hengqin Tunnel. Customs officers quickly inspected and released the goods worth over 7 million yuan from Xinchao (Zhuhai) Technology Co., Ltd., marking the official landing of the first bonded research and development business in the Hengqin Cooperation Zone.

This is just a microcosm of the accelerated formation of Hengqin's "bonded+" industrial ecosystem. In the past two years, the Hengqin Cooperation Zone has expanded from a single bonded logistics to diversified formats such as bonded display, bonded processing, and bonded leasing. Biopharmaceuticals, chip processing, and other industries have grown rapidly, and the agglomeration effect of key platforms such as integrated circuit design industrial park and traditional Chinese medicine technology industrial park continues to emerge.

Many Australian funded enterprises are the first to taste the policy's "first taste soup". The branch line management has expanded the scope of entities and goods eligible for tax exemption policies, bringing tangible dividends to institutions such as the Zhuhai University of Science and Technology Research Institute. Multiple batches of related equipment are eligible for tax exemption policies, effectively promoting the deep linkage between industry, academia, and research in Qin'ao.

Cultural and tourism exhibitions are also full of highlights. The customs have simplified customs clearance procedures and increased policy supply through addition and subtraction. From the successful holding of the first AIE Expo to the efficient exchange of cultural exhibits such as Sanxingdui cultural relics between the two places, the integration momentum of Qin'ao's "one exhibition, two places" continues to be released.

Integration: Expanding the Field of Rule Connection

Behind the acceleration of Qin'ao integration is the deep connection of rules between the two regions. At the beginning of the implementation of the sub line management, the customs focused on the connection mechanism between the Qin'ao rules, and 15 cross-border cooperation mechanisms were included in the "four beams and eight pillars" to support the smooth implementation of the sub line management in the Hengqin Cooperation Zone.

In the past two years, Gongbei Customs has focused on the connection of Qin'ao rules and mechanisms, and has created a series of pioneering measures in areas such as customs clearance management, health quarantine, agricultural and food product safety supervision, customs clearance cooperation, and technical cooperation, continuously expanding the scope. Currently, 22 cross-border cooperation mechanisms have been formed, and "Qin'ao Same City" has gradually transformed from a beautiful vision to a real experience for residents and enterprises in both places.

While benchmarking against international high standard economic and trade rules, the customs have innovated new models such as "one code traceability" for food, guiding Macau food production enterprises to conduct production and business activities in accordance with mainland food safety regulations and technical specifications, and promoting the two-way aggregation of "Macau elements" and "mainland elements".
